About The Position

The Communication Consultant - Employee Experience at WTW is responsible for developing and executing communication plans that promote clients' benefit programs. This role requires strong project management skills, effective writing abilities, and knowledge of employee benefits, along with the capacity to present ideas to various management levels. The consultant will work closely with clients to create tailored communication strategies that drive engagement and support organizational goals.
